Practical Approaches for⁤ Farmers: Implementing Soil Health Solutions

Farmers⁣ seeking to ‌enhance their soil health ⁣can employ a variety of sustainable practices that ‍foster​ a vibrant ecosystem. ⁢ Cover⁣ cropping is one powerful method, involving ⁣the‌ planting of specific crops during fallow periods to ⁢protect the soil​ from erosion, enhance nutrient​ cycling, ‌and suppress weeds. Additionally, ‍incorporating⁤ crop ⁣rotations allows‍ farmers⁤ to ​disrupt pest cycles, improve soil structure, and promote ‌biodiversity. Another effective practice is the use of compost and organic amendments to enrich the soil with ⁤essential nutrients while improving its ⁣water retention⁣ and microbial activity.

Understanding the ​role of ⁣soil microbes is crucial for improving​ soil ⁣health. By leveraging soil testing tools provided by AMVAC ⁢GreenSolutions and‍ Biome Makers, ⁢farmers ‌can assess ⁤their soil’s nutrient⁢ content and microbial ‍diversity. This analysis enables tailored soil management strategies that optimize‍ inputs while⁣ minimizing environmental impact. Implementing integrated pest management (IPM) techniques can also synergize with⁤ soil health efforts, as it focuses⁤ on ecological balance and reducing chemical⁣ inputs. Here’s a summary ​of these practical ​approaches:

Practice Benefit
Cover Cropping Prevents erosion, enhances nutrient cycling
Crop ⁣Rotation Disrupts pest cycles, promotes biodiversity
Compost Application Improves ⁢nutrient ​availability⁣ and ‌microbial activity
Soil Testing Informs​ tailored​ management strategies
Integrated Pest Management (IPM) Reduces chemical inputs, promotes ecological balance
